BOYS’ CROSS-COUNTRY

Colin FitzGerald, Evan Pattinelli at Foot Locker West Regional: A week removed from a disappointing 45th-place showing at the CIF State Division I final, FitzGerald turned in a stellar showing at Saturday’s Foot Locker Cross Country Championships West Regional at Mount San Antonio College.

The Crescenta Valley High junior finished 12th in 15 minutes 55.1 seconds.

The race was won by Utah senior Talon Hull in 15:28.3. FitzGerald was the third-highest junior finisher and the fourth-highest non-senior. He was the fourth Californian across the finish line.

As for Pattinelli, the Flintridge Prep junior and reigning CIF Southern Section Division V champion, took 39th in 16:23.3.

GIRLS’ BASKETBALL

Hoover 38, Baldwin Park 23: Mary Cantos collected a team-high 16 points and Khiara Almendras added eight on Saturday to lead the Tornadoes (1-3) in the seventh-place game of the Rosemead Tournament.

Cantos earned a spot on the all-tournament team.

Marshall Fundamental 35, St. Monica Academy 14: If there’s good news for the Crusaders, it’s that the San Marino Tournament is over.

St. Monica Academy closed out an 0-5 run through the tournament Saturday morning with the defeat.

BOYS’ BASKETBALL

South Pasadena 61, Flintridge Prep 50: Flintridge Prep closed out its first week of action at the Providence Tournament at 2-2 with a loss on Saturday despite a game-high 22 points from Jake Althouse.

Jonathan Le had 11 points for the Rebels, while Kendall Kikkawa had seven.

Glendale 60, L.A. Marshall 57: The Nitros closed out the Burbank Winter Tournament on Saturday with a victory, which brought their record to 2-3.

St. Monica Academy 44, New Harvest Christian 38: The Crusaders improved to 2-1, 1-1 in the International League win at home Friday.

BOYS’ SOCCER

Crescenta Valley 5, Taft 1: The Falcons relinquished their first goal of the season in Saturday’s win in the Ralph Brandt Tournament, but still continued their impressive start.

Henry Barkhordarian tallied a hat trick in the match and Dallas Kaauwai had a goal and an assist. Ryan Sanfillippo also had a goal.

Crescenta Valley improved to 3-0, 2-0 in the tournament and has outscored its opponents by a combined 10-1 score.

St. Francis 1, Sylmar 0: The Golden Knights won at home Saturday in the Ralph Brandt Tournament to move to 2-0-1.

Sherman Oaks Notre Dame 2, Hoover 1: The Tornadoes were dealt their first loss, dropping to 2-1 on the season with Saturday’s loss in the Ralph Brandt Tournament.

GIRLS’ SOCCER

Flintridge Sacred Heart Academy 1, Pasadena Poly 1: The Tologs kept their record even at 1-1-1 with Saturday afternoon’s nonleague tie on the road.
